Q: What's your association with Disney Toontown Online?

Toontown Online Sign Up and Play Screenshot.png

A: You ask a lot of questions. :P

Well, Toontown has been a hobby of mine since as long as I can remember! It was the first MMORPG I ever discovered on the internet, and as I've heard, it's speculated to be the pioneer MMO to be family-oriented, at least according to sources such as Jesse Schell, which is pretty cool I guess.

I remember I first heard about Toontown in 2007 because of the commercials on the Disney Channel. It looked fun, but I never gave it much attention. But that summer my sister announced to me that she received this email about some Toontown promotion. It was late at night and I really didn't have anything else to do, and I remembered seeing some of the gameplay from Disney commercials, so I thought it would it would be a great idea to start playing.

And I didn't doubt myself for one second. It was the best gaming experience I've ever had online, after all it didn't take much to appease a seven year old. xD

Regardless of its antiquated gameplay and coding base, there was just something about it that was addicting and kept me playing for a very long time. It was probably because of its originality, between the characters, the gameplay, the combat weapons, the world and much more.
